Different types of nucleic acids are deoxyribonucleic acid (DNA), ribosomal ribonucleic acid (rRNA), transfer ribonucleic acid (tRNA), and messenger ribonucleic acid (mRNA). Another important difference between deoxyribonucleic acid and ribonucleic acid is that the deoxyribonucleic acid is double-stranded while ribonucleic acid is single-stranded. Deoxyribonucleic acid (DNA) and ribonucleic acid (RNA) are two types of nucleic acids. DNA stores genetic information of most living organisms. Unlike DNA, RNA is a single stranded molecule with chain lengths ranging from 10 to more than 1000 nucleotides and serves various biological functions in an organism's cell. MicroRNA (miRNA) was discovered in 1993 in nematodes when the Caenorhabditis elegans heterochronic gene lin-4 was identified as a small non-coding RNA (ncRNA).
